El Progreso, Guatemala - April 30, 2024

The National Coordinator for Disaster Reduction (CONRED) has reported several incidents caused by rain and strong winds in various parts of Guatemala.

According to CONRED reports, flooding was recorded in the Las Champas hamlet in El Progreso. Images depict torrents of water flooding the streets of the area.

Additionally, CONRED reported flooding in several homes in Malacatancito, Huehuetenango.

The incidents highlight the vulnerability of communities to the adverse effects of extreme weather conditions, prompting swift response efforts from authorities to ensure the safety and well-being of affected individuals.

CONRED continues to monitor the situation closely and provides necessary assistance to areas impacted by the inclement weather.
